"Windows 7 Home Premium Lite x64" is an unofficial, modified version of Microsoft's operating system. It is designed for legacy hardware and low-resource PCs by stripping out non-essential services and features to reduce disk and RAM usage. Core Differences & Features

  • Windows 7 Home Premium Lite x64 is a 64-bit version of Windows 7 Home Premium.
  • It is a popular choice among users who want a lightweight and efficient operating system.

1. Performance: The "Lite" Advantage

The primary selling point of this OS is speed. By removing heavy bloatware—such as Windows Media Center, natural language support, rarely used drivers, and the massive collection of default wallpapers—this version achieves a remarkably small footprint. "Windows 7 Home Premium Lite x64" is an
